Transaction 789279e8f5966c140e31a572614fa19cdcafcad393495e309c17e88e3cb1b0d7
1 Input
1 Output
-
789279e8f5966c140e31a572614fa19cdcafcad393495e309c17e88e3cb1b0d7:0
- value
- 4561375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be5138cee463c990f5dfe7a1cd1fbf3ed4beb01f OP_EQUAL
- address
- 3K3KcPVNmJbreCGD7VFXotar5L2jL888mZ